## Tide-Table Widget 101

Hey, new on-call friend! The Brackenport tide widget pulls predictions from our Moonwake forecast service every six hours and caches them locally. If the widget shows stale tides, the usual culprit is an expired cache, not the upstream feed. To run the refresher locally you'll need the Moonwake client set up, so drop this line into your environment file:

sealed setting: ARCHIVE_KEY3=8d0

Two prod pods are still using the pre-migration font-cache path and the old page-margin profile, producing invoices that fail the Brindlemoor layout check. The batch job retries these endlessly, which is what paged you. Short-term: drain the stale pods and let the scheduler replace them. Do not hand-edit configs on the hosts; that caused this drift originally. After replacement, confirm all pods match the canonical settings. The expected production configuration is listed below for verification.

deployment values, kajep-kageg:
[praix]
host = praix.paliqcorp.corp
user = praix_svc
database = praix_prod

These stem from intermediate rounding: conversions pass through a pivot currency, and each hop rounds to the target's minor unit. The platform uses banker's rounding throughout; plugins that round half-up locally will disagree on boundary values. Do not compensate in plugin code — instead, request raw high-precision amounts via the ledger API and round once at display time. The conversion service runs with the following configuration values.

config for fajep-bajeg:
WENIX_HOST=wenix.qorvelsys.internal
WENIX_PORT=8000